Soil Preparation and Fertilization

Healthy soil is the foundation of successful organic vegetable gardening. Begin by testing your soil to determine its pH level and nutrient content. Ideal soil pH for most vegetables ranges between 6.0 and 7.0. Amend your soil based on test results to ensure it is fertile and well-balanced.

Organic matter is critical for enriching soil structure, improving moisture retention, and providing nutrients. Incorporate compost, well-rotted manure, or leaf mold into the soil before planting. These materials not only supply essential nutrients but also promote beneficial microbial activity.

Avoid synthetic fertilizers, as they can disrupt soil ecology and potentially harm beneficial organisms. Instead, use organic fertilizers such as:

  • Bone meal (high in phosphorus)
  • Blood meal (high in nitrogen)
  • Fish emulsion (balanced nutrients)
  • Kelp meal (rich in trace minerals)

Regularly mulching your vegetable beds helps conserve moisture, regulate temperature, and suppress weeds, all of which contribute to healthier soil conditions.

Organic Fertilizer Primary Nutrient Best Use Application Rate
Bone Meal Phosphorus Root development, flowering 2-4 lbs per 100 sq ft
Blood Meal Nitrogen Leafy growth 1-2 lbs per 100 sq ft
Fish Emulsion Nitrogen, Phosphorus, Potassium General feeding Apply as a 1:5 dilution every 2-3 weeks
Kelp Meal Trace minerals Stress tolerance, overall health 1-2 lbs per 100 sq ft

Watering Techniques for Organic Gardens

Consistent and appropriate watering is vital for organic vegetable growth. Overwatering can lead to root rot and nutrient leaching, while underwatering stresses plants and reduces yield. Use the following guidelines to optimize water use:

  • Water deeply and infrequently to encourage deep root development.
  • Early morning watering reduces evaporation and fungal disease risks.
  • Use drip irrigation or soaker hoses to deliver water directly to the soil and reduce water waste.
  • Mulch around plants to maintain soil moisture and temperature.

Monitor soil moisture by feeling the soil 1-2 inches below the surface; it should be moist but not soggy. Adjust watering frequency based on weather conditions, soil type, and plant growth stage.

Pest and Disease Management Without Chemicals

Managing pests and diseases organically requires an integrated approach focused on prevention and natural controls rather than synthetic pesticides.

Cultural practices such as crop rotation, interplanting, and selecting disease-resistant varieties reduce pest and disease pressure. Maintaining plant health through proper nutrition and watering improves resilience.

Physical barriers like row covers protect crops from insect pests without chemicals. Handpicking pests and using traps are effective for small-scale gardens.

Beneficial insects such as ladybugs, lacewings, and predatory nematodes naturally control pest populations. Encourage their presence by planting insectary plants like dill, fennel, and yarrow nearby.

If pest populations become severe, organic-approved treatments such as neem oil, insecticidal soap, or diatomaceous earth can be applied carefully and as a last resort.

Choosing Seeds and Plant Varieties

Selecting the right seeds and varieties is crucial for organic success. Opt for seeds labeled as organic or untreated to avoid exposure to synthetic chemicals. Heirloom and open-pollinated varieties are often preferred for their genetic diversity and adaptability.

When choosing varieties, consider:

  • Disease resistance to common local problems
  • Growth habit and maturity time suited to your climate
  • Flavor and texture preferences

Start seeds indoors or directly sow in the garden depending on the crop and season. Seedlings grown organically ensure the entire lifecycle remains chemical-free.

Crop Rotation and Companion Planting Strategies

Crop rotation breaks pest and disease cycles by alternating plant families in the same soil over successive seasons. For example, follow nitrogen-fixing legumes like beans with heavy feeders such as tomatoes or brassicas.

Companion planting involves growing plants with mutually beneficial relationships together. Examples include:

  • Basil planted near tomatoes to improve flavor and repel pests
  • Marigolds used to deter nematodes and certain insects
  • Corn, beans, and squash grown together in the “Three Sisters” method for mutual support

These practices enhance biodiversity, improve soil health, and reduce pest problems naturally.

Choosing Suitable Soil and Preparing the Garden Bed

Selecting the right soil and preparing your garden bed effectively are foundational steps in growing organic vegetables. Organic gardening relies heavily on soil health, which directly impacts plant growth and yield.

The ideal soil for organic vegetable gardening is loamy, well-draining, and rich in organic matter. Before planting, conduct a soil test to determine pH levels and nutrient content. Most vegetables thrive in soil with a pH between 6.0 and 7.0. Adjust pH accordingly using natural amendments such as lime to raise pH or sulfur to lower it.

Garden bed preparation involves the following steps:

  • Clear the area: Remove weeds, rocks, and debris to reduce competition and barriers to root growth.
  • Loosen the soil: Use a garden fork or tiller to aerate the soil to a depth of 8 to 12 inches, promoting root penetration and water retention.
  • Add organic matter: Incorporate well-aged compost or manure to improve soil structure, fertility, and microbial activity.
  • Level the bed: Create a smooth, even surface to ensure uniform irrigation and planting depth.
Soil Property Optimal Range for Organic Vegetables Recommended Organic Amendments
pH 6.0 – 7.0 Dolomitic lime (to raise pH), elemental sulfur (to lower pH)
Organic Matter Content 5% or higher Compost, aged manure, leaf mold
Drainage Well-draining but moisture-retentive Sand (to improve drainage), compost (to retain moisture)

Selecting Vegetable Varieties and Planning Crop Rotation

Choosing vegetable varieties well-suited to your climate and soil conditions enhances the success of organic gardening. Opt for disease-resistant and locally adapted cultivars to reduce the need for interventions.

Crop rotation is essential to maintain soil fertility and prevent pest and disease buildup. Rotating crops according to their botanical families disrupts pest life cycles and balances nutrient demand.

  • Plan rotation cycles: Divide your garden into sections and rotate families yearly. Common vegetable families include:
Vegetable Family Examples Soil Nutrient Use
Nightshades Tomatoes, peppers, eggplants High nitrogen and phosphorus demand
Legumes Beans, peas Fix nitrogen, replenish soil nitrogen
Brassicas Cabbage, broccoli, kale High nitrogen demand
Root Vegetables Carrots, beets, radishes Moderate nutrient demand
  • Intercropping: Consider planting complementary species together to maximize space and pest control, such as planting basil alongside tomatoes.
  • Succession planting: Plan staggered sowing to ensure continuous harvest and efficient use of garden space.

Implementing Organic Pest and Disease Management

Maintaining plant health without synthetic chemicals requires integrated pest management (IPM) strategies that focus on prevention, monitoring, and control using natural methods.

Key organic pest and disease management techniques include:

  • Cultural practices: Maintain proper spacing to improve airflow, remove diseased plant material promptly, and rotate crops to reduce pest habitat.
  • Biological controls: Encourage beneficial insects such as ladybugs, lacewings, and predatory wasps that prey on common pests.
  • Physical barriers: Use row covers, netting, or collars around plants to physically exclude pests.
  • Organic pesticides: Apply natural substances such as neem oil, insecticidal soaps, or Bacillus thuringiensis (Bt) when pest populations exceed threshold levels.

Regular monitoring is critical to detecting early signs of infestation or disease. Use yellow sticky traps or manual inspection to track pest populations. Maintain a garden journal to record observations and evaluate the effectiveness of interventions.

Frequently Asked Questions (FAQs)

What are the essential steps to start growing organic vegetables?
Begin by selecting a suitable location with ample sunlight, prepare nutrient-rich soil using organic compost, choose certified organic seeds or seedlings, and implement natural pest control methods. Consistent watering and crop rotation are also crucial for healthy growth.

How can I improve soil fertility organically?
Incorporate organic matter such as compost, aged manure, or green manure crops into the soil. Use cover crops to prevent erosion and enhance nutrient content. Avoid synthetic fertilizers to maintain soil health and microbial activity.

What natural methods can control pests in an organic vegetable garden?
Employ companion planting, introduce beneficial insects like ladybugs, use neem oil or insecticidal soaps, and practice crop rotation. Physical barriers such as row covers can also protect plants from pests without chemicals.

How often should organic vegetables be watered?
Water deeply and consistently to keep the soil moist but not waterlogged. Frequency depends on climate and soil type, but generally, watering once or twice a week is sufficient, increasing during hot or dry periods.

Is it necessary to use organic seeds for growing organic vegetables?
Using organic seeds is highly recommended to maintain the integrity of organic gardening. Organic seeds are produced without synthetic chemicals and support sustainable farming practices, ensuring the vegetables remain truly organic.

Can I grow organic vegetables in small spaces or containers?
Yes, container gardening is effective for organic vegetables in limited spaces. Use high-quality organic potting mix, ensure proper drainage, and select suitable vegetable varieties. Regular feeding with organic fertilizers supports healthy growth.
